Indexing Rotator
Indexing Rotators are Double and Single Gobo Rotators which allow you to stop and start the gobo's rotation precisely, whenever and wherever you want. This is particularly useful for repetitive effects, such as the hands of a gobo clock, or for architectural effects, such as a shop display window.

Indexing Rotators are controlled through DMX512 and the DMX addressing facility is built into the unit. You control both the speed and direction of the rotation as well as the indexing position (up to 180 degrees available) and the amount of time the gobo stays in that position. A Power Supply Unit is necessary to get 24v DC to the Indexer(s) and you can daisy chain multiple units from one Power Supply Unit.

Rosco's Double and Single Indexers are compatible with many common PSU's already available including: Wybron-Forerunner PSU; Rainbow-Mini, Maxi, and Micro PSU's; Christie Lites-Color Q PSU; AC Lighting-Chroma Q PSU. We also offer a line of Power Supply Units by Rosco which are specifically designed for optimal compatibility for both Indexers and I-Cue units.

Vortex 360 Dual Rotator™
The VORTEX 360 Dual Rotator is one of the most versatile accessories ever offered to lighting designers. And its incredibly low price makes it possible for any theatre or venue to have several copies available to cover any space or meet any need.

The sleek unit houses two carefully crafted gear drives, both made of stainless steel, to assure long term operation. A single silent motor drives both gear assemblies. Even at full speed, the VORTEX 360 Dual Rotator is so quiet it can be used anywhere in a theatre or venue - including front-of-house positions in a theatre or grids on low ceilings in restaurants or stores.

The VORTEX 360 Dual Rotator will fit the iris slot of the ETC Source Four, the Altman Shakespeare, Strand SL and the Selecon Pacific. It will accept standard B size (86 mm) steel or glass gobos. The VORTEX 360 is plug and play simple and requires no additional power supply to operate. A 12v transformer is included and can be plugged directly into a wall outlet.

The rotational speed of the VORTEX 360 can be adjusted by the simple potentiometer knob conveniently positioned on the top of the unit or by plugging the 12v transformer into an electronic dimmer capable of handling inductive loads. When powered through a dimmer, the operator can control the speed of rotation through the lighting control board. Please check with the dimmer manufacture before using the VORTEX in this fashion. Failure to use a compatible dimmer can result in overheating and/or damage to both the VORTEX and the dimmer.

The Vortex 360 includes a three-way toggle switch, discreetly located just under the handle. The switch allows your customers to turn the unit off and on and to control the direction of rotation. The front and rear gears rotate opposite each other - but the switch allows the user to determine whether the front or rear will operate clockwise.

Warning: Always attach a safety cable from the VORTEX to fixture housing.

Double Gobo Rotator
The Double Gobo Rotator allows you to achieve kinetic and often spectacular lighting effects by rotating two gobos in the same or opposite directions, at the same or varying speeds. The exceedingly quiet operation of this 2.5 lb unit allows it to be used in virtually any lighting position.

This rotator fits the ETC Source Four or the Altman Shakespeare or 1K. it requires a controller or MFX Control Adapter.

X-Effects Projector
The X24-Effects Projector provides large scale 3-D effects previously unavailable to lighting designers. The device utilizes a 200-watt Enhanced Metal Arc source, whose short arc allows for an ouput of 5000 lumens, and a 7000 hour lamp life. The color termperature is similar to a Xenon source at 6000K, but with nearly two times the luminous effectiveness.

The effect itself is created by rotating two "X" size glass gobos off-center of the optical path. This results in a projection that does not appear to have a visible direction or pattern. Onboard potentiaometers control the speed and direction of both gobos.

The X-Effects Projector is available in two configurations. For theatrical entertainment lighting, specify the model with DMX on board. Using five DMX channels, the unit has full control of effect gobo, lamp strike and light output. For retail or museum displays, where DMX is not usually required, specify the anolog model. All units are equipped with a lamp and a customer-chosen lens train.

Infinity™ - Gobo Animation
This gobo animation device offers superb kinetic lighting effects combined with simplicity of use and low cost.

The Infinity™ device affixes to the gel frame of virtually any spotlight. You can choose from among 11 animation disks listed in the Rosco catalog and web site. Affix one of the disks to the device, place a steel or glass gobo in the gate, plug the Infinity into an outlet or dimmer ­ and watch magic appear on your stage or studio. The Infinity is equipped with on-board control of the Infinity Disk speed and direction, as well as an on/off switch.

The Infinity Disks are stainless steel disks that are 16.5" (42 cm) in diameter and are available in eleven different etched pattern designs. The disks, being out of the focal plane, allows sharp focus on the gobo in the pattern slot while the rotating disk animates the effect of the gobo. The effect of rotating these disks creates moving effects such as fire, water or leaves. The key to the system is to choose the right gobo for the base effect.

The Infinity™ device is entirely self-contained. You won't need additional controllers or power supplies. It will fit the gel frame of luminaries such as Altman 1-K and any fixture with 7-1/2" gel frame. It is also supplied with an adaptor plate for Source-4 sized fixtures or any luminary with a 6-1/4" gel frame. It is also supplied with a user specified Infinity Disk.
